Package: pcscd
Version: 1.4.100-3
Severity: important

*** Please type your report below this line ***

Bonjour,

I cannot read the content of an belgian electronic identity card inserted in a acr 38 reader. The reading application (beidgui) reports that there is no card in the reader. The reader and card are new and working on a another computer running another operating system.
If I take a look in the /var/log/syslog file, I see the following:

+++ When plugin reader cable in usb port +++

May 17 23:53:28 max kernel: usb 1-5: new full speed USB device using ohci_hcd and address 9
May 17 23:53:28 max kernel: usb 1-5: configuration #1 chosen from 1 choice
May 17 23:53:28 max pcscd: hotplug_libhal.c:341:HPAddDevice() Adding USB device: usb_device_72f_9000_noserial_6_if0 May 17 23:53:29 max pcscd: readerfactory.c:1130:RFInitializeReader() Attempting startup of ACS ACR38U 00 00 using /usr/lib/pcsc/drivers/ACR38UDriver.bundle/Contents/Linux/ACR38UDriver.so May 17 23:53:29 max pcscd: readerfactory.c:963:RFBindFunctions() Loading IFD Handler 2.0 May 17 23:53:29 max kernel: usb 1-5: usbfs: process 11180 (pcscd) did not claim interface 0 before use

+++ When inserting card in driver +++

May 17 23:54:23 max pcscd: eventhandler.c:437:EHStatusHandlerThread() Card inserted into ACS ACR38U 00 00 May 17 23:54:23 max pcscd: eventhandler.c:451:EHStatusHandlerThread() Error powering up card.

+++ When removing the card +++

May 17 23:54:33 max pcscd: eventhandler.c:364:EHStatusHandlerThread() Card Removed From ACS ACR38U 00 00

+++ when unpluging the reader +++

May 17 23:54:42 max kernel: usb 1-5: USB disconnect, address 9
May 17 23:54:42 max pcscd: hotplug_libhal.c:422:HPRemoveDevice() Removing USB device[0]: usb_device_72f_9000_noserial_6_if0 May 17 23:54:42 max pcscd: eventhandler.c:120:EHDestroyEventHandler() Stomping thread. May 17 23:54:42 max pcscd: eventhandler.c:145:EHDestroyEventHandler() Thread stomped. May 17 23:54:42 max pcscd: readerfactory.c:1181:RFUnInitializeReader() Attempting shutdown of ACS ACR38U 00 00. May 17 23:54:42 max pcscd: readerfactory.c:1042:RFUnloadReader() Unloading reader driver.

+++ when I ask the beidgui to read the content of the card +++

May 18 00:24:38 max pcscd: winscard.c:363:SCardConnect() Card Not Powered

I tried the reader and card on a another computer running another operating system and there it works. The brand of the smart card reader is ACS. The model is ACR38U-CFC-BLI. see http://www.belgeid.be/ I use the reader driver provided by debian : libacr38u & libacr38ucontrol0 version 1.7.9-3 I also tried the reader driver provided by the manufacturer of the reader : (fedora rpm) acr38udriver version 1.8.0-2
In this case I see in the syslog :
May 17 22:56:05 max pcscd: hotplug_libhal.c:341:HPAddDevice() Adding USB device: usb_device_72f_9000_noserial_5_if0 May 17 22:56:06 max pcscd: readerfactory.c:1130:RFInitializeReader() Attempting startup of ACS ACR38U 00 00 using /usr/lib/pcsc/drivers/ACR38UDriver.bundle/Contents/Linux/ACR38UDriver May 17 22:56:06 max pcscd: readerfactory.c:997:RFBindFunctions() Loading IFD Handler 3.0
when pluging the reader.
The version of the card related software: beid-tools, beidgui, libbeid2 & libbeidlibopensc2 is 2.6.0-3.1 I'm not sure at all that the bug is located at your side because I do not clearly understand the software stack between the hardware and the me. But the only "error" information i see comes from pcscd.

I hope I give you enough information to begin to investigate where this issue could be located.

Thanks in advance.

Gérard.

-- System Information:
Debian Release: lenny/sid
 APT prefers testing
 APT policy: (500, 'testing')
Architecture: i386 (x86_64)

Kernel: Linux 2.6.24-1-amd64 (SMP w/1 CPU core)
Locale: LANG=fr_BE.UTF-8, LC_CTYPE=fr_BE.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ash

Versions of packages pcscd depends on:
ii  hal                         0.5.11~rc2-1 Hardware Abstraction Layer
ii  libc6                       2.7-10       GNU C Library: Shared libraries
ii libccid [pcsc-ifd-handler] 1.3.5-1 PC/SC driver for USB CCID smart ca ii libdbus-1-3 1.2.1-2 simple interprocess messaging syst ii libhal1 0.5.11~rc2-1 Hardware Abstraction Layer - share ii lsb-base 3.2-11 Linux Standard Base 3.2 init scrip

pcscd recommends no packages.

-- no debconf information



--
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to